mad,

The only problem I see with your combo is the timing and maybe short duration on the exhaust side of the cam. The timing is rather counterintuitive in as much that my combo picked up greatly as we backed off from my initial setting of 36 total all the way back to 30 total. It was worth about 12 HP/15 ft.lb. across the power band. One thing to bear in mind is that pump gas burns FASTER than race fuel, it just has a little less energy. If you use too much advance, you may not be getting detonation, but your peak pressure is building too early and being wasted trying to fight itself going over TDC. The Eddie RPM's are a little small for the 500's in their stock form and what we learned was we were starting to get exhaust scavenging issues past 5000. The heads simply couldn't get the exhaust all the way out. It needs more duration on the exhaust by at least 6°, plus more lift doesn't hurt either. Yours is better than mine on the exhaust, so you may be OK there. My cam was spec'd and purchased for my engine right before I lost the stock 440 crank and went stroker. If I do go solid flat rather than roller next time, I'll be getting one more like yours, but with even a tad more exhaust duration. One last thing is that the engine responded VERY well to a 1" 4-hole on top of a 1" open, so the added volume of your Victor manifold is a good thing.

Properly sorted, you should be in the 630 - 640 range with at least 650 ft.lb. Your peak will still be under 6000 due to the small Eddies.

Did you upgrade the main caps and go to head and main studs? Anything past 600 on stock caps and bolts is begging for trouble and will at least have serious cap-walk issues.
